Plans to dig a shallow rail tunnel just 10 metres beneath Swanston Street have been binned by the Andrews government, which has chosen instead to go deep and put a new CBD station almost 40 metres underground to avoid digging up the city's spine.
The decision to dig deeper beneath the CBD means trams will be able to run along Swanston Street during construction of the $9 billion-$11 billion Melbourne Metro tunnel.
